On-orbit vibration testing for space structuresA simulated on-orbit modal test using active members as the excitation source has been performed on the Precision Truss. Using the step sine testing technique, the frequency response functions are obtained and the modal parameters are extracted by the curve-fitting method. A total of 10 global modes and 3 local modes are obtained. The results are compared with those obtained by the conventional external excitation test.
